Transaction f8fb48e955788c5bfb6b1e83d8c9688211a29632d35f24766b219e51b416715b
2 Input
2 Outputs
- f8fb48e955788c5bfb6b1e83d8c9688211a29632d35f24766b219e51b416715b:0
- f8fb48e955788c5bfb6b1e83d8c9688211a29632d35f24766b219e51b416715b:1
value 707491
address 1GLWSCNgGhJihtUmW4vCNQWPkrPXTBQwZp
value 20774063
address 3Dcb1MbyWhHZb9sA6YnBGLAoF6FkS4Yrwo